Course Overview
In OneNote, notebooks never run out of paper. Notes are easy to organize, print, and share, and you can search and find important information quickly, even if you forget where you've originally captured it. Best of all, your notebooks are stored online so you can easily get to them on any of your mobile devices.
Course Objectives
-
- Explore the Microsoft OneNote interface and create a simple notebook.
- Create notes using Microsoft OneNote.
- Organize content and search for information in a Microsoft OneNote notebook.
- Integrate OneNote with other applications.
- Use OneNote to share notes with other people.

Prerequisites
-
- Delegates should be familiar with using personal computers and have used a mouse and keyboard (basic typing skills are recommended). They should be comfortable in the Windows environment and be able to use Windows to manage information on their computers. Specifically, they should be able to launch and close programs; navigate to information stored on the computer; and manage files and folders.
